Megan Elizabeth Dahle (née Ray; born July 29, 1975) is an American politician serving as a member of the California State Senate since 2024. A Republican, she represents the 1st State Senate district, which encompasses all or part of 13 counties in the northeastern corner of California, from Lake Tahoe to the Oregon border, including the northern Sierra Nevada region.

On June 4, 2019, Dahle won a special election to fill the State Senate seat vacated by Ted Gaines, who resigned after his election to the California State Board of Equalization. [4] After Dahle joined the State Senate, his wife Megan Dahle was elected to his vacated Assembly seat. Dahle was the Republican nominee for governor of California in 2022.
